The phrase "a pooling of capabilities"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e the act of combining or sharing skills, resources, or strengths among individuals or groups for a common purpose.
Example: "The project was successful due to a pooling of capabilities from various departments, allowing for a more comprehensive approach."
Alternatives: "a collaboration of skills" or "a gathering of resources".
